🗄️ Databases & Backend

Perché il tuo drive NVMe odia il doublewrite buffer di MySQL durante l'elaborazione massiccia di immagini

Caricare immagini non dovrebbe affossare il database. Eppure, quando i temi WordPress gonfiano wp_postmeta, il doublewrite buffer di MySQL trasforma l'NVMe in una lumaca.

Visualizzazione blktrace delle scritture doublewrite buffer di MySQL in concorrenza su NVMe durante stall di elaborazione immagini

⚡ Key Takeaways

  • La concorrenza sul doublewrite buffer di MySQL esplode per esaurimento buffer pool durante scritture bursty come i metadati immagini WordPress. 𝕏
  • Blktrace rivela flush doublewrite sync in coda dietro l'I/O app, non limiti di throughput. 𝕏
  • Rispondi con storage dedicato, parametri innodb tunati e update CMS batch — non condividere l'NVMe. 𝕏
Published by

DevTools Feed

Ship faster. Build smarter.

Worth sharing?

Get the best Developer Tools stories of the week in your inbox — no noise, no spam.

Originally reported by dev.to

Stay in the loop

The week's most important stories from DevTools Feed, delivered once a week.